Inside the tunnel, an array of nozzles arranged in a surrounding layout ensures that when containers enter along the track, they are subjected to water curtains from all directions. High-pressure spraying removes stubborn stains attached to the containers, while high temperatures are used for sterilization. At the end of the tunnel is a dewatering section where containers are air-dried and heat-dried to meet quality standards for immediate use.
To ensure the quality of decontamination and sterilization, the cleaning process is divided into four stages: pre-wash, main wash, rinse, and final wash, each with distinct characteristics and functions.Pre-wash features high temperature and large water flow (the most nozzles), aimed at sterilizing, removing grease, and softening stubborn residues.Main wash features high temperature and high water pressure, aimed at deep sterilization and powerful decontamination. Rinse features high temperature but a short duration, aimed at rinsing off contaminated water from the container's surface. Final wash features ambient temperature and high-quality water, aimed at restoring the container to a clean state ready for immediate use.
To improve water resource utilization, the equipment is equipped with a three-tier separate tank system. Each tank supplies water to a specific cleaning stage, and after use, the water is recycled back into the corresponding tank for filtration and reuse. Pipes connect the tanks so they are interconnected. Tap water is introduced externally for the final rinse and then enters the tank system, raising the water level in the upstream tank. The water subsequently flows through pipes into the midstream and downstream tanks, replenishing water levels and purifying the water quality. Contaminants floating on the surface of the downstream tank are continuously discharged from the system.
At the end of the tunnel is the container dewatering section, where air dryers and heat dryers are used to remove residual water from the containers. The air dryer is equipped with a self-developed wind knife device that also adopts a surrounding layout. It can convert the airflow generated by the compressor into a high-speed air curtain in sheet form to strip off the remaining water on the container surface. The heat dryer has an additional heating device that utilizes the heat from the air curtain to accelerate moisture evaporation, thereby improving dehydration efficiency.
